The living room of this property is square shaped and designed in a stunning warm-coloured palette. The plush caramel coloured sofa is furnished on one end and complemented by custom designed cream coloured leather accent loungers, while the media wall is designed directly opposite to it in a contrasting, rich walnut brown laminate that also matches the surrounding wall accents. 

The relaxing, earthy-hued wall claddings are incredibly flexible and chosen for long-term application – even if the homeowners change their furniture, the wall designs would remain timeless. The whole room is anchored gorgeously with an oversized, white shag rug that caps off the whole design beautifully.

The elegant dining room design of this contemporary chic home provides the most stimulating ambiance. With a sophisticated Bolia statement pendant light grounding the whole ambiance, a Greyhammer dining table that was specially craned in to the 2nd floor, and custom made dining chairs that cap off the whole look, this space speaks volume in luxury. The feature length mirror-clad wall gives the visual illusion of a doubled space, which enhances the narrow layout of the dining room.

Foyers are transitional spaces and the one designed for this contemporary chic home is supposed to be a reflection of what’s to come on the main living areas of the second floor. It’s designed with stunning wood frets and accent mirrors to elevate the texture and glamour of the space. The piano brings the whole ambiance together and symbolizes the cozy, family-oriented use of the space. It’s topped off by a statement painting done by the homeowner’s daughter, so it brings a nice personal touch to the interior design.

The master bedroom is designed for comfort without compromising the style. The headboard is gorgeously tufted and showcases a trendy play on textures and unique finishes. The floating nightstands are accompanied with tall mirrors on each side and are followed by the chic laminate fret panels with a beautiful statement décor in the middle. The cream-and-brown color scheme reflects the sophistication of the living area and unifies the whole theme of the house’s interior design.

The homeowners have two daughters and the youngest’s room has been finished in classy, timeless, and evergreen whites. Contrary to being difficult to maintain, the colour emulates a clean, neutral look that always feels fresh and inviting. To give the whites some depth and texture, the headboard has been finished in channel stitches with white leather-like fabric. It has been paired with a beautiful Mid Century Modern style off-white Egg Chair, which circular shape contrasts the linear channel stitching of the bed headboard.

The eldest daughter’s bedroom is located in the attic and its interior has been carried out in charismatic, urban chic dark tones that are three shades darker than the rest of the home. This enriches the room with a lot of character and has been articulated with the help of a feature headboard with ash-wood textured finishes and classy mirror accents that resemble but do not imitate the rest of the house’s interior designing.
